How much goes for human food, animal food, and biofuels? According to the U.N. Convention to Combat Desertification, it takes up to 10 pounds of grain to produce just 1 pound of meat, and in the United States alone, 56 million acres of land are used to grow feed for animals, while only 4 million acres are producing plants for humans to eat. In the US to produce one pound (1 lb, 0.4kg) of steak requires, on average, 1,799 gallons of water - for pork it is 576 gallons of water and for a pound of chicken it is 468 gallons of water.
